What is a decade in frequency?


Sharing is Caring


A decade change in frequency is a factor of ten. So, for example, 1 kHz is a decade above 100 Hz and a decade below 10 kHz. An “octave” is a factor of two, so similarly 1 kHz is an octave above 500 Hz and an octave below 2 kHz.

What is octave and decade?

An octave is defined as a doubling or a halving of a value of frequency. A decade is defined ten times (or a tenth of) any quantity (or frequency range); this means the values are not fixed, but relative. The frequency range of the human ear is approximately ten octaves or three decades from 20 Hz to 20000 Hz.

Why Bode plot is 20 dB decade?

Because the frequency scale increases in “Decades” (multiples of x10) it is also a convenient way to show the slope of the gain graph, which can be said to fall at 20dB per decade.
